Course Content

• Introduction to the African Diaspora: History, Culture, and Identity
• African Diaspora in the Digital Age: E-Learning and Technology
• The Impact of Colonialism and Globalization on the African Diaspora
• African Diaspora Communities: Diversity and Transnationalism
• Education and Development in the African Diaspora: Challenges and Opportunities
• African Languages and Digital Literacy in the Diaspora
• Case Studies in African Diaspora E-Learning Initiatives
• Creating Inclusive and Culturally Relevant E-Learning Materials for the African Diaspora
